What if I get disconnected during the tests?

While we hope that no one will experience technical difficulty while taking the tests, glitches of various kinds do sometimes affect network connections. At times, if you remain relatively inactive on your computer for a while, your Internet service provider may disconnect you. While this does not happen often, it can be frustrating if it occurs. If you are disconnected while filling out an answer to a test question, your answers to all of the questions you have completed will be saved in our system. To continue the tests, log back in to this Web site within a few minutes of being disconnected (http://www.psu.edu/ftcap/webtest/) and click "Log Back In."

If you try to reconnect and continue to experience problems, or if you are unable to log back in to the Web site within 20 minutes (for example, if a power outage has occurred), you will need to contact the FTCAP Web Testing Helpline (814-865-8270) or l-ftcap-tech@lists.psu.edu within 24 hours of the next business day* to obtain permission to log back in.

* Business days are Monday - Friday.
